Corey Crowned Champion of Premier League Predictor

Congratulations to Corey Ryan who has won our Premier League Predictor competition.

Corey certainly proved that age and wisdom don’t necessarily go hand in hand. It is his first taste of success and the €250 win is one he kept rather cool about at the presentation on Saturday. His father Neil has yet to confirm whether it will be going towards a college fund, straight into the Credit Union or if it could be left to rest in another account.

He paced himself over the course of the competition finishing with a tally of 140 (20, 30, 20, 20, 30, 20). We were delighted to see him wearing the club jersey for the presentation and we hope to see him lining out for the Blues in years to come.
